Job Description Key Information: Designation: Project Engineer Department: Projects Location: Hyderabad (requires extensive travel) Experience: 4+ years Roles and Responsibilities: Conduct initial site surveys and generate comprehensive site recce reports. Assess site feasibility and compliance with regulatory and project requirements. Coordinate with internal teams for timely design and technical layout approvals. Liaise with landlords and building management for site access and procedural approvals. Develop and manage internal project schedules to monitor progress. Manage vendor coordination for on-site execution across multiple locations. Monitor vendor adherence to execution checklists, quality standards, and MIR protocols. Prepare and circulate snag reports, identify pending or defective works, and follow up for closures. Handle procurement and ensure the timely delivery of materials related to Alt F’s scope. Oversee site-level material receipt, validation, and quality checks. Ensure complete and compliant project handovers from vendors. Coordinate smooth transition to operations or facility management teams. Cross-verify layout implementations and asset installations for design compliance. Manage vendor follow-ups during the Defects Liability Period (DLP). Assess feasibility and manage the execution of client-specific customization requests. Requirements Prerequisites: Bachelor’s degree in Engineering (Mechanical, Civil, Electrical, or equivalent). Minimum of 4 years of relevant experience in project execution, vendor management, and MEP oversight. Possesses a strong understanding of Mechanical, Electrical & Plumbing (MEP) systems for technical site evaluations and issue resolution Strong communication and stakeholder management skills. Proven ability to manage multiple sites with frequent travel. Proficiency in MS Office, project scheduling tools, and report generation.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and project layouts.
